Dear Colleagues,

I am pleased to inform you that we have reached a tentative agreement with the Rochester City School District for a one-year extension of the current (2015-2018) contract that expires on June 30, 2018. Everything in our agreement would remain the same – including the 3.61% increase for the next (2018-2019) school year.

Ratification balloting by all teachers will be held at every school and work location on Tuesday, March 13. The Board of Education is scheduled to vote on this tentative agreement later in March.

If the proposed one-year extension is approved by teachers and the Board of Education, we will immediately resume Living Contract negotiations of the very important priorities that you’ve identified through our negotiations survey and forums (school safety, student discipline, class sizes, Paid Family Leave, sick days bank, reduced paperwork, and so much more). Issues not successfully resolved by Living Contract bargaining would then become part of our proposals in negotiations for the next multi-year contract.

The proposed extension of our contract comes at a time of fiscal uncertainty for our District and a potentially perilous period for unions and public education. If ratified, it will give us the needed time to bargain for a multi-year successor contract that would continue our drive for a more genuine teaching profession and more effective schools for all our students.
